Latest Stickerbomb book raises a toast to the world's best craft beer brewing designs

Creative Boom

Sticker-obsessed publisher Stickerbomb has turned its attention to the independent beer industry in its latest book celebrating the world's coolest brewery branding. As its name suggests, the urban art publisher is passionate about all things sticker related, directing this devotion to a whole host of magnificent titles focused on the arts.

Van Saiyan's incredible retro illustrations draw on special moments from his childhood

Creative Boom

© Van Saiyan Spanish illustrator Van Saiyan recalls special moments from his childhood when creating gloriously retro artwork that evokes the look and feel of old-school pulp comics. His illustrations have appeared in editorial columns for the likes of The Washington Post, Forbes and Entertainment Weekly.

Jenny Hamasaki's stunning oracle deck illustrations are steeped in Japanese folklore and culture

Creative Boom

Published by tarot card specialists Arcana Sacra, this oracle deck invites people to embark on a journey of self-discovery guided by "the wisdom and beauty of Japan." If they're reading The Oracle of the Rising Sun cards, they're also treated to the stunning illustrations drawn by Jenny Hamasaki, also known as Jenny à la Mode.
